Stan James started out in 1973 as a single betting office in the Oxfordshire market town of Wantage just 15 miles or so from Newbury racecourse. Although not as large as other British bookmakers, StanJames horse racing are former Champion Hurdle sponsors of the 2m Grade 1 race at the Cheltenham Festival. Like many other bookmakers, StanJames have grown their digital presence through a series of mergers with other operators and clever sponsorship of notable sporting events. These have naturally included horse racing and the King George VI Chase at Kempton on Boxing Day enjoyed a four-year partnership with them starting in 2005 and ending in 2008. If you’re wondering who owns StanJames now, it’s the Unibet Group who acquired in 2015. You’ll know is StanJames horse racing good or not by the time you reach our conclusion. The StanJames sportsbook contains a big selection of horse racing odds and market. You can back outright win and each-way, with also forecast and exacta bets available on StanJames horses on the day of races. They also offer the best odds guaranteed on all UK and Irish horse racing every day, but you have to opt in to it unlike other bookmakers. Be on the lookout for daily top price offers from 10am too!. Keep in mind that BOG  now applies only to UK and Irish Horse Racing and Greyhounds.
